凉城旧巷
Python从入门到自闭,Java从自闭到放弃,数据库从删库到跑路,Linux从rm -rf到完犊子!!!
摘要: 元类 一、什么是元类 1、在python中,一切皆对象,而对象都是由类实例化得到的。对象是调用类或自定义类得到的,如果说一切皆对象,那么自定义类也是一个对象,只要是对象都是调用一个类实例化得到 2、对象tea1是调用类OldboyTeacher产生的,而OldboyTeacher类也是通过调用一个类 阅读全文
posted @ 2018-08-27 16:14 凉城旧巷 阅读(152) 评论(0) 推荐(0) 编辑
摘要: 异常处理 一、什么是异常处理 异常是错误发生的信号,一旦程序出错就会产生一个异常,如果该异常没有被应用程序处理,那么该异常就会抛出来,程序的执行也随之终止 二、异常的内容 (1) traceback异常的追踪信息(2) 异常的类型(3)异常的信息 三、异常的分类(错误分为两大类) (1) 语法上的错 阅读全文
posted @ 2018-08-27 15:32 凉城旧巷 阅读(116) 评论(0) 推荐(0) 编辑
摘要: isinstance与issubclass、反射、内置方法 一、isinstance与issubclass方法 1、isinstance是用来判断对象是否是某个类 isinstance(obj,class) 2、issubclass是用来判断一个类是否为另一个类的子类 issubclass(Bar, 阅读全文
posted @ 2018-08-23 21:03 凉城旧巷 阅读(122) 评论(0) 推荐(0) 编辑
摘要: classmethod、staticmethod装饰器 一、绑定方法与非绑定方法 1、绑定方法(绑定给谁,谁来调用就自动将它本身当作第一个参数传入): (1) 绑定到类的方法:用classmethod装饰器装饰的方法。 为类量身定制 类.boud_method(),自动将类当作第一个参数传入 (其实 阅读全文
posted @ 2018-08-22 11:54 凉城旧巷 阅读(117) 评论(0) 推荐(0) 编辑
摘要: 组合、多态、封装、property装饰器 一、组合 1、什么是组合 组合指的是某一个对象拥有一个属性,该属性的值是另外一个类的对象 1 class Foo(): 2 pass 3 4 class Bar(): 5 pass 6 7 obj=Bar() 8 obj.attrib=Foo() 2、组合的 阅读全文
posted @ 2018-08-21 15:58 凉城旧巷 阅读(144) 评论(0) 推荐(0) 编辑
摘要: 继承 一、什么是继承 继承是一种创建新类的方式,新建的类可以继承一个或多个父类(python支持多继承),父类又可称为基类或超类,新建的类称为派生类或子类。 二、继承的特点 1.继承描述的是事物的遗传关系,子类可以重用父类的属性 2.在Python中支持一个子类继承多个父类 3.Python类分为两 阅读全文
posted @ 2018-08-20 15:31 凉城旧巷 阅读(137) 评论(0) 推荐(0) 编辑
摘要: 面向对象 一、面向对象编程与面向过程编程 1、面向过程编程思想 该思想核心是过程,指的是解决问题的步骤,即先干什么再干什么。基于该思想编程就像一条流水线,是一种机械式的思维方式 优点:复杂问题简单化,流程化 缺点:可扩展性差 应用场景:一旦完成基本很少改变的场景,著名的例子有Linux內核,git, 阅读全文
posted @ 2018-08-17 18:11 凉城旧巷 阅读(352) 评论(0) 推荐(0) 编辑
摘要: ATM+购物车 1、需求分析 2、程序设计及目录设计 3、编写程序 4、调试程序 阅读全文
posted @ 2018-08-15 20:51 凉城旧巷 阅读(113) 评论(0) 推荐(0) 编辑
摘要: 常用模块(四) 一、subprocess模块 详见:https://www.cnblogs.com/linagcheng/p/14379208.html 1、subprocess为子流程模块,用于执行系统命令,该模块在Python全栈开发中不常用 2、常用方法 run 返回一个表示执行结果的对象 c 阅读全文
posted @ 2018-08-14 16:32 凉城旧巷 阅读(216) 评论(0) 推荐(0) 编辑
摘要: 常用模块(三) 一、shelve模块 1、shelve模块也是一种序列化模块,内部使用的是pickle模块,所以也存在跨平台性差的问题 2、特点: 只要提供一个文件名即可 读写的方式和字典一样 将数据以类似字典的形式在文件中读写 3、应用场景 在单击的程序中使用 4、使用方法 (1)序列化 (2)反 阅读全文
posted @ 2018-08-13 18:47 凉城旧巷 阅读(293) 评论(0) 推荐(0) 编辑